About the role
Responsibilities
- Design and execute independent research projects centered on 3D genome organization in cancer
- Perform and optimize chromatin conformation assays, including HiChIP, HiC and related targeted 3D genome methods
- Generate and integrate complementary epigenomic datasets, including ATAC-seq, CUT&RUN, CUT&Tag
- Contribute to or initiate single-cell and spatial multi-omics projects
- Work with patient-derived organoid models
- Perform and optimize NGS library preparation protocols across multiple assay types
- Collaborate closely with computational scientists for data analysis and interpretation
- Lead manuscript preparation and contribute to grant development
- Mentor trainees and contribute to a collaborative lab environment
Requirements
- Ph.D. in Molecular Biology, Cancer Biology, Genomics, or a related field
- Strong experimental background in functional genomics and epigenomics assays
- Hands-on experience with next-generation sequencing (NGS) library preparation
- Experience with chromatin-based assays (e.g., ATAC-seq, HiC-based methods, CUT&RUN)
- Proven ability to independently design and execute experiments
- Strong publication record
- Excellent communication skills and fluency in English
- Ability to work effectively in a collaborative, multidisciplinary environment
Preferred Qualifications
- Direct experience with 3D genome assays (Hi-C, HiChIP, Capture-C)
- Experience with organoid culture systems
- Exposure to single-cell or spatial genomics technologies
- Basic familiarity with computational analysis using R or Python
